Valet key

Valet keys make it easy to give your car to an attendant or mechanic. They are master keys that are cut in half that are able to start your car but not open the trunk or glove box. They are typically used in high-end vehicles that have lots of expensive equipment inside. However, they are not 100% secure, and can be stolen if they are not kept in a secure location. If you're concerned about your belongings, you should make sure that your car was equipped with a valet keys and keep it in a safe place.

A valet key can lock the doors and trunk if the FOB battery dies this is a good feature to have. This is useful for people who often lend their cars to others, like taxi drivers. Transponder key

Transponder keys are required by a lot of modern automobiles to start. This high-security key has an embedded computer chip in the key's head, and copper wiring that connects it to the car's onboard computer. When the key is put into the ignition barrel, the coil in the car sends out a signal of electromagnetic energy which gets to the chip, causing it to send an indication of the car's identification number. If the ID code matches the same that the immobilizer is disarmed and the engine will begin.

A regular transponder looks like a metal car keys cut by code key with a plastic cover. The transponder itself is housed in this piece of plastic, which is available in three different types of keys: a standard cut like the one in this picture or a laser key cutting cut (also called a sidewinder key), or a tibbe key.

The key's plastic top has a unique serial number that's etched on the surface. This information is needed to make a matching key for the car. Locksmiths can program and cut a new transponder for a fraction of the cost of what dealerships would charge.

When the key is inserted in the ignition, a tiny circuit inside the transponder chip transmits an electrical signal to the antenna ring inside the ignition. The signal contains an identification code that matches one stored in the memory of the car. If the car can recognize the chip, it will shut off the immobilizer and allow the engine to start. This is a fantastic security feature for cars, since it is almost impossible to hot wire a car that has this technology.
